Transaction 33a81fd29f243bbfb0e3e6cc8e7250c69b8d84910ea9f3394018331fccddaf4f
1 Input
1 Output
-
33a81fd29f243bbfb0e3e6cc8e7250c69b8d84910ea9f3394018331fccddaf4f:0
- value
- 1991568
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38a7408ba5b6cf09fb90f254a692f864a26cfae7 OP_EQUAL
- address
- 36ra8AhXaogMHBg3cyX8JSRh3sdfo1RmTP